Key Ingredients for Creamy Lemon Chicken Orzo Pasta, One Pan Skillet

Chicken: I recommend using boneless, skinless chicken breasts for your creamy lemon chicken orzo pasta. They cook quickly and stay juicy, perfect for a one-pan dish. If you’re short on time, shredded rotisserie chicken is a fantastic shortcut!

Orzo: This tiny pasta has a charming shape that blends beautifully with the other ingredients. Cooking orzo directly in the skillet with chicken and broth allows it to soak up all those delicious flavors while achieving that creamy texture we crave.

Chicken Broth: A high-quality broth is essential for infusing your dish with rich, savory goodness. Opt for low-sodium broth, so you can control the saltiness and let the bright lemon flavor shine through.

Lemon Juice & Zest: Fresh lemon juice and zest are the stars of this dish. The zest brightens the creaminess, while the juice adds a vibrant, tangy contrast that keeps every bite exciting.

Cream: A splash of heavy cream gives our creamy lemon chicken orzo pasta that luscious, smooth consistency. It balances the acidity of the lemon, making each forkful a delight.

Essential cooking techniques for perfect chicken

To achieve tender, juicy chicken for your Creamy Lemon Chicken Orzo Pasta, start with room temperature meat. Bringing chicken to room temperature before cooking helps it cook evenly. Use a meat thermometer to ensure it’s perfectly cooked at 165°F. For that golden-brown crust, pat the chicken dry with a paper towel and season generously with salt and pepper before searing.

Tips for seasoning and flavor balancing

When it comes to flavor, consider layering your seasonings. Begin with salt and pepper for the chicken, then add fresh herbs like thyme or parsley during cooking for depth. Don’t forget to adjust the acidity with the lemon juice; if it feels too sharp, balance it out with a pinch of sugar or a touch of honey.

How to achieve creamy consistency without heavy cream

To create that rich, creamy texture in your dish, use Greek yogurt or coconut milk instead of heavy cream. Stir in a couple of tablespoons at the end of cooking for an added silkiness. Additionally, the starch from the orzo as it cooks will help thicken the sauce beautifully without heaviness.

Can I cook this in advance?

Absolutely! You can prepare your creamy lemon chicken orzo pasta ahead of time, making it a fantastic option for meal prep. Just follow the recipe until the cooking stage is complete, then cool the dish and store it in an airtight container in the fridge. Reheat gently on the stove or in the microwave, adding a splash of broth or water to ensure it remains creamy.

How do I store leftovers?

Leftovers are a breeze to store. Just place any remaining creamy lemon chicken orzo pasta in a well-sealed container in the refrigerator. It should stay fresh for about 3-4 days. If you’re really keen on keeping it for longer, you can freeze the dish, but note that the texture may change slightly once reheated.

Description

A delicious and creamy chicken and orzo dish with a hint of lemon and fresh spinach.


Ingredients

Scale
  • lb boneless, skinless chicken breast
  • 1 Tbsp extra-virgin olive oil
  • ½ yellow onion
  • 3 cloves garlic
  • 1 tsp paprika
  • 1 tsp dried oregano
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• ½ tsp kosher salt
  • ¼ tsp black pepper
  • 2 cups chicken broth
  • 1 cup orzo pasta, dry
  • 2 cups baby spinach
  • ¼ cup Greek yogurt
  • ½ cup grated parmesan cheese
  • 24 Tbsp lemon juice
  • 1 tsp lemon zest

Instructions

  1. Cut the chicken into bite-sized pieces. Dice the onion and mince the garlic.
  2. Heat a large skillet over medium heat. Add the olive oil and heat until it shimmers. Add the onion. Saute for 3-4 minutes until translucent.
  3. Add the chicken, garlic, and seasonings. Make sure the chicken is coated in the seasonings. Cook for 3-4 minutes on one side, undisturbed. Flip and cook another 3-4 minutes until fully cooked to an internal temperature of 165℉ (75°C).
  4. Add the orzo pasta and chicken broth to the cooked chicken. Give it a good stir and bring to a boil. Lower heat and cover. Simmer on low heat for 12 minutes, stirring occasionally to prevent the orzo from sticking to the bottom of the pan.
  5. Remove the lid and simmer another 2-4 minutes uncovered until orzo is cooked. Cook time will vary a bit based on your pan and stovetop.
  6. At the end of cooking, stir in the spinach until it wilts. Turn off heat and stir in the Greek yogurt, parmesan, lemon juice, and lemon zest. Give it a taste and add more salt as needed.

Notes

  • There will still be excess liquid when you first turn off the heat. Don’t worry! The orzo will continue to absorb it as it cooks.
